The most famous late-night host is often considered to be Johnny Carson. Hosting 'The Tonight Show' from 1962 to 1992, Carson's wit and charm set the standard for late-night TV. His influence continues to be felt in the careers of many hosts who followed, including David Letterman and Jay Leno.
